site stats

Synchronous vs asynchronous reset verilog

WebNov 1, 2011 · Add a comment. 5. Asynchronous reset with synchronous de-assertion works very well. As mentioned above, async reset flops are smaller and don't require a clock … WebThere is one (and only one) difference between a synchronous reset and an asynchronous reset, and it has to do with the assertion of reset: When a synchronous reset is asserted, the output will go to the reset value after the next rising edge of clock; When an asynchronous reset is asserted, the output will go to the reset value immediately; An ...

Synchronous & Asynchronous Reset – VLSI Pro

http://cwcserv.ucsd.edu/~billlin/classes/ECE111/lectures/Lecture3.pdf WebJan 29, 2024 · 4 Answers. Sure! You're wrong! "Asynchronous reset" means that a reset takes place immediately when the reset signal changes state. "Synchronous reset" means that a reset takes place when at the time of the rising clock edge, the reset signal is asserted. And that's exactly what's shown on your slides. dezinfikujeme https://toppropertiesamarillo.com

By default synchronous reset gate will be considered - Course Hero

Webis to strictly use synchronous resets”, or maybe, “asynchronous resets are bad and should be avoided.” Yet, little evidence was offered to justify these statements. There are some … WebTemplate specifies async reset edge -triggered D -FFs Positive edge-triggered on “clk” Async reset negative edge on “reset_n” RHS taken from FF output LHS goes into FF . resets on neg edge of reset_n WebAsynchronous versus Synchronous Resets I Reset is needed for: I forcing the ASIC into a sane state for simulation I initializing hardware, as circuits have no way to self-initialize I Reset is usually applied at the beginning of time for simulation I Reset is usually applied at power-up for real hardware I Reset may be applied during operation by watchdog circuits beach legal mount maunganui

Synchronous Resets? Asynchronous Resets? I am so …

Category:Asynchronous reset synchronization and distribution - Embedded

Tags:Synchronous vs asynchronous reset verilog

Synchronous vs asynchronous reset verilog

Asynchronous Reset Verilog? The 7 Latest Answer

WebJun 23, 2024 · If your design contains registers which lack reset capability, such as RAM blocks, then using asynchronous reset on the registers feeding adr, data and control signals to the RAM can cause corruption of the RAM content when a reset occurs. So if you need the ability to do a warm reset where RAM content must be preserved: Use synchronous warm ... WebFeb 21, 2024 · Now the difference between Synchronous and Asynchronous Circuits is in how the circuit goes for one Internal State to the Next Internal State. In a Synchronous Sequential Circuit all the State Variables representing the internal state of the circuit change their state simultaneously with a given input clock signal to achieve the next state. On ...

Synchronous vs asynchronous reset verilog

Did you know?

WebFeb 8, 2015 · The best answer for blocking vs non-blocking flip-flops assignment is already answered on Stack Overflow here.That answer also references to a paper by Cliff Cummings, here. Now, the code for your second attempt will always result in with the behavior shown in the waveform, even with non-blocking assignments:

WebJan 6, 2000 · The reset circuit in Figure 1 asserts the reset signal immediately after detecting the asynchronous reset signal. However, the circuit also synchronizes the reset release with the clock. The circuit uses this synchronized asynchronous-reset signal to drive a state machine that uses flip-flops and the asynchronous-reset input. The reset circuit ... WebUse Synchronized Asynchronous Reset Verilog HDL Code for Synchronized Asynchronous Reset. 2.3.3. Use Clock Region Assignments to Optimize ... You should use synchronizer …

WebJan 9, 2024 · The flip-flop of FPGA (at least those from Xilinx or the ECP5 family from Lattice) support both synchronous and asynchronous reset (extract from the ECP5 datasheet : "There is control logic to perform set/reset functions (programmable as synchronous / asynchronous)".The only way I can think of is to have a sync DFF and an … http://referencedesigner.com/tutorials/verilog/verilog_56.php

http://www.sunburst-design.com/papers/CummingsSNUG2003Boston_Resets.pdf

WebUnlike the synchronous reset, the asynchronous reset is not inserted in the datapath, and does not negatively impact the data arrival times between registers. Reset takes effect immediately, and as soon as the registers receive the reset pulse, the registers are reset. The asynchronous reset is not dependent on the clock. beach lima peruWebWhat is synchronous reset and asynchronous reset explain about synchronous and asynchronous resetreset removel and reset appliedsynchronous d flip flop veri... beach lot for sale batangasWebOct 21, 2015 · In this post, I share the Verilog code for the most basic element in the synchronous domain - a D flip flop. There can be D flip flops with different functionalities whose behavior depends on how the flip flop is set or reset, how the clock affects the state of the flip flop, and the clock enable logic. dezinflacja co to jestWebApr 14, 2024 · Use synchronous design practices: Employ synchronous design practices, such as using edge-triggered flip-flops for state storage and avoiding asynchronous resets, to improve the predictability and stability of your design.. 4. RTL Synthesis. After completing the RTL coding phase, the next step in the RTL design process is RTL synthesis. beach lp2 kayakWebAug 11, 2024 · The choice between a synchronous or asynchronous reset depends on the nature of the logic being reset and the project requirements. Advantages and … dezinfekcija je metoda kojom se postižeWebApr 14, 2024 · Use synchronous design practices: Employ synchronous design practices, such as using edge-triggered flip-flops for state storage and avoiding asynchronous … dezinformace o ukrajineWebFIR Filter Asynchronous FIFO design with verilog code D FF without reset D FF synchronous reset 1 bit 4 bit comparator All Logic Gates Sram verilog code Jobs Employment Freelancer October 11th, 2024 - Search for jobs related to Sram verilog code or hire on the world s largest freelancing marketplace with 14m jobs It s free to sign up and bid on ... beach limania